Ave Maria, Florida, is a vibrant, master-planned community in Collier County, founded by Tom Monaghan, blending small-town charm with modern amenities, located about 25 miles east of Naples. Known for its family-friendly and faith-based atmosphere centered around Ave Maria University, the town offers a lively town center with a Publix supermarket, boutique shops, and dining options like The Pub and Oar & Iron, serving craft brews and fresh seafood. Recreational amenities include the Panther Run Golf Club, an 18-hole championship course, and North and South Parks, featuring sports fields, a dog park, an amphitheater, and picnic areas. The Ave Maria Water Park provides family fun with pools and slides, while nearby Big Corkscrew Island Regional Park offers a state-of-the-art playground and future canoe/kayak launches. Cultural attractions like the Mother Teresa Museum and the striking Ave Maria Oratory, along with events such as the weekly farmers’ market and the annual Ave Maria Festival, foster a strong community spirit, enhanced by trails, pickleball courts, and proximity to nature at Corkscrew Swamp Sanctuary.
